Title: Akio Saito: Innovator in Film-Forming Compositions
Introduction
Akio Saito is a notable inventor based in Mie-ken,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of film-forming compositions, holding a total of 2 patents. His work focuses on enhancing the properties of materials used in various applications.
Latest Patents
Saito's latest patents include a "Composition for resist underlayer film and method for producing the same" and an "Acrylic copolymer and reflection-preventing film-forming composition containing the same." These innovations involve a reflection-preventing film-forming composition that includes a copolymer with specific structural units and a solvent, showcasing his expertise in material science.
